The graphical abstract is circular with three sections. Inputs listed on the left include AI surveillance, blockchain evidence, mobile forensics, geospatial mapping, and legal frameworks. Core enforcement listed at the bottom includes data collection, real-time detection, and cross-agency sharing. Outputs on the right include targeted interventions, judicial admissibility, reduced trafficking, public safety, and policy feedback. The circle with the phrase graphical abstract in the centre symbolises the cycle where inputs lead to enforcement, which produces measurable outputs for drug control and regulation.Graphical abstract: Inputs–Core Enforcement–Outputs for a tech-enabled NDPS regime
